New Delhi, July 23 (IANS) Defence Minister Rajnath Singh and Union Health Minister J.P. Nadda on Thursday welcomed Prime Minister Narendra Modi's decision to establish fast-track courts for the speedy trial of those accused in paper leak cases, saying that safeguarding the future of the country's youth remains the "topmost priority" of the Modi government.

New Delhi, July 23 (IANS) The Delhi Police on Thursday issued a public advisory urging citizens to verify information through official sources before sharing content on social media, amid the ongoing protests at Jantar Mantar over the NEET paper leak. The appeal came after misinformation spread on social media regarding the death of a woman protester who was injured during the police action on students on Monday and was admitted to hospital.
